Gavin’s been riding around in his sister’s hand-me-down stroller. It’s faded, and the wheel keeps popping off. It’s time to get the boy his very own stroller. I really wanted a Maclaren..but I couldn’t swallow the $3oo price tag. I looked on Craigslist..even used Maclaren’s were running about $150! I did a little research and looked at strollers with the same features without the giant price. I picked the Zooper Twist in the new green color. It has a 5 pt harness..the seat reclines..looks great! I paid about $190. It’s beautiful and rolls like a dream! Here’s my only complaints…
1. You cannot recline the seat with one hand. Very annoying when you have a baby melting down..you’re trying to recline and give a bottle.
2. The trim on the shade is yellow..when the stroller is folded up, the wheels touch the trim…dirty-dirty-dirty.
Overall, the stroller looks cool. The recline drives me crazy..but I can live with it. But, they really need to change the color of the trim!

Looking back..I now realize Macy was very easy to potty train. She showed all the signs..way before I was ready! Around 18months..I noticed, (and ignored) that she was waking up in the morning dry. A little over the age of 2..I dropped her off for a play date at Audrey’s house..when I picked her up..Audrey’s mom commented on how she stayed dry for 4 hours..I pushed that aside too. At around 2 1/2- 2 3/4 I left for a trip. Dad threw out his back cleaning the carpet when Macy tried to change her own diaper. Ok..it was time. I am all about the bribe. I took her to the video store to pick out a video to potty train too. “Beauty & the Beast.” I bought a potty chair for the living room and a potty seat for the bathroom. I dressed her in a big t-shirt..nothing underneath. Commando! I explained what we were doing..and would only let her watch the video if she sat on the potty seat. And shortly after she became addicted to the video..I promised to buy it for her after she was potty trained. I planned on staying home until we were done. We really didn’t have any major accidents..She caught herself mid-stream a few times and ran for the potty! Same with #2. We only stayed home for 3 days! Yahoo!
As for the promised princess video..I was a clueless new mom who didn’t realize that Disney doesn’t just sell videos when you want to buy them..I ended up buying one on e-bay from China!
